Ordinals
beta
Sat 1827064519872590
decimal
621651.769872590
degree
0°201651′723″769872590‴
percentile
87.00307247058866%
name
axfyudceplr
cycle
0
epoch
2
period
308
block
621651
offset
769872590
timestamp
2020-03-14 20:10:23 UTC
rarity
common
prev
next